What Does This Test Measure and Detect?
This advanced genetic screening specifically targets mutations in the PUS3 gene that are associated with autosomal recessive mental retardation type 55. The test employs sophisticated NGS technology to identify:
- Pathogenic variants in the PUS3 gene coding regions
- Single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) affecting protein function
- Insertion and deletion mutations impacting gene expression
- Copy number variations that may disrupt normal neurological development
- Inheritance patterns consistent with autosomal recessive transmission

Understanding Your Test Results
Our expert genetic counselors will help you interpret your results with clarity and compassion:
- Positive Result: Indicates presence of pathogenic PUS3 gene mutations, confirming diagnosis of autosomal recessive mental retardation type 55
- Negative Result: Suggests absence of detectable PUS3 mutations in tested regions, though other genetic causes may still be present
- Variant of Uncertain Significance: Identifies genetic changes with unknown clinical impact, requiring further evaluation
- Carrier Status: Determines if individuals carry one copy of mutated gene without showing symptoms
